The hexadecimal color code #00FBF6 corresponds to the code RGB( 0, 251, 246 ). It's a shade of Green. This color is a combination of red (at 0,00 level), green (at 0,98 level) and blue (at 0,96 level). Its brightness is 49% and its saturation is 100%. It is composed of red at 0%, green at 50% and blue at 49%.
